Fiberglass Repair FAQ


Small gelcoat chips or “spider cracks” typically cost between $200 and $500 to repair. Larger gouges or structural repairs are usually quoted by the hour (averaging $125–$175/hr) plus materials. Pricing depends heavily on the complexity of the color match, especially with multi-colored metal flake.


Yes, provided the repair is done by a certified professional using proper grinding, layering, and resin infusion techniques. A structural repair isn’t just a “patch”; it involves rebuilding the laminate schedule to ensure the hull is as strong—or stronger—than the original factory build.


Gelcoat is a thick, durable resin-based outer layer that is part of the mold process, while marine paint is an aftermarket finish applied over the surface. For most Midwest fiberglass boats, gelcoat is the preferred repair method as it bonds chemically with the hull and offers superior impact resistance.


Signs of a failing transom include visible “weeping” from bolt holes, hair-line cracks in the splashwell, or the motor “flexing” when you trim it up. In the Midwest, moisture trapped in wood-core transoms is a leading cause of failure.


Yes, but it requires a climate-controlled shop. Epoxy and polyester resins require consistent temperatures (typically above 65°F) to cure properly. Most Midwest fiberglass pros handle their major structural projects during the off-season to ensure the boat is ready by the spring thaw.
